Discovering Kotor’s Rich History

dubrovnikmontenegro-day-trip-kotor-bay-short-boat-cruise

While exploring Kotor, visitors are immediately captivated by its rich history, evident in the city’s well-preserved medieval architecture and ancient fortifications.

The iconic St. Triphun Cathedral, dating back to the 12th century, showcases Romanesque and Gothic influences, while the impressive city walls reflect centuries of strategic defense.

Wandering through narrow cobblestone streets, one encounters the Maritime Museum, which highlights Kotor’s seafaring legacy.

Each corner reveals a story, from the Venetian influence to the city’s role in trade.

Kotor’s vibrant past is alive, inviting travelers to enjoy its tales and appreciate the blend of cultures that shaped this stunning destination.

What’s Included and Excluded

dubrovnikmontenegro-day-trip-kotor-bay-short-boat-cruise

When planning a day trip to Dubrovnik and Kotor, travelers should be aware of what’s included and excluded in the tour package to ensure a smooth experience.

The package includes hotel pickup and drop-off, transportation by air-conditioned bus, a knowledgeable guide, sightseeing cruise, local taxes, and entrance fees.

The tour package features hotel pickup, air-conditioned bus transport, a knowledgeable guide, a sightseeing cruise, and all necessary entrance fees.

However, food and drinks, including lunch, aren’t covered, and gratuities are recommended but not mandatory.

Keep in mind that the tour isn’t suitable for individuals with mobility impairments.

Important Travel Information

Travelers should be well-informed about important details before embarking on their day trip to Dubrovnik and Kotor. A valid passport or ID card is required for entry into Montenegro, so it’s crucial to have that handy.

Comfortable walking shoes are recommended to navigate the scenic paths. It’s also important to check visa requirements beforehand.

Pets aren’t allowed on the tour, ensuring a smooth experience for everyone. Customers will receive an email with pickup details and times, so staying updated is key.

Lastly, expect minor delays at the border but rest assured, the overall experience remains enjoyable.
